For the Mac users out there...
Open Macintosh HD/Applications/Utilities/Terminal.
Then past in this code and press enter.
/System/Library/Frameworks/ScreenSaver.framework/Resources/ScreenSaverEngine.app/Contents/MacOS/ScreenSaverEngine -background &
This sets your screensaver as the desktop background. :o
To undo this, and revert to your old desktop bakground, past in this code and press enter.
killall -9 ScreenSaverEngine
